"We conducted a post-hoc analysis of part of the data from the randomized controlled REMIND-HIV trial, in which PLHIV had been randomly allocated to (1) RTMM, (2) Short Message Service (SMS) reminder texts or (3) standard of care and followed for 48 weeks. Details of the trial have been described elsewhere []. The study was approved by the College Research and Ethical Review Committee (CRERC) of Kilimanjaro Christian Medical University College (KCMUCo) and the National Health Research Ethics Sub-Committee (NatHREC) of the National Medical Research Institute (NIMR) of Tanzania. The trial was registered at the Pan African Clinical Trials Registry under PACTR201712002844286."
